First round vs. career outcomes
Volume and quality are different signals. A program can lead in raw picks while another turns fewer selections into more Pro Bowlers. The Pro Bowler rate next to each school shows how often its picks became long-term NFL contributors, so read it alongside the Round 1 column rather than instead of it.
